Install SAP Cloud Connector (SCC)

SCC is required to secure connectivity from BTP to SAP Solution


Manager to be located close to SAP Solution Manager in your
data center
 Create virtual machine based on sizing guidelines – click here.
Recommend to use a medium size
 Install SCC using the download from here and install instructions for
your chosen OS (Windows, Linux or Mac)

When installed review the following help files to finalise the


installation
 Initial Configuration for HTTP
– Required to complete this for beta testing
– Recommended to use the create & import self-signed certificate for
beta testing – config will show valid system certificate
 Recommendations for secure set-up
– Not mandatory for beta but recommended for production
– If your new to SCC, then this is recommended reading for rolling into
productive usage

Connect SAP Cloud Connector (SCC) to sub-account

SCC must now be connected to your subaccount for


the beta test
 Follow steps form this guide here
– Region is eu10 (AWS Frankfurt) or us10 (AWS Virginia)
– Please provide a Location ID e.g. customer name or
abbreviation just using uppercase letters and numbers
– Your user is your email and your password is your SAP
universal ID’s password

 Once connected, verify the SCC is connected in your


account
– Logon to the subaccount overview using
– Click on “Connectivity", then "Cloud Connectors” on the
lefthand menu
– Screen should show your connector as active

Connect SAP Signavio Process Manager

System Name – Can be found from SAP Signavio Process Manager ‘Help  Workspace information’

Data Center – Please select the data center where your Signavio workspace

Workspace Tenant ID – is found in menu path Help  Workspace information (as above)

System Role – used to distinguish between Test and Productive workspaces for documentation purpose.

Description – free text, describing your selected workspace. Keep it short. It will be visible in the Connected system list to help
the user to navigate between multiple Signavio workspaces.

Connect SAP Solution Manager
Host Name & Port number – is the hostname & port you use to connect to your Solution Manager system via a browser

Service User /Password – are details of the SAP Solution Manager system Service
user. If you don’t have one, please ask your system administrator to set it up and ask
them to allocate the roles described at this link.

Certificate Type – select “Trusted” if your SolMan system has an officially signed system certificate installed. Otherwise select “Untrusted”

Connect SAP Solution Manager
The summary page shows the key information which is required for the final step to create a Cloud-to-OnPremise trust
relationship for this system in your SAP Cloud Connector

Key information:
 Host name is used as the logical
hostname when define the trust
relationship
 Port number is used for both the
virtual & logical port number in the
trust definition
 Virtual URL is used for the Virtual
host name in the trust definition

These details must be shared with your


Cloud Connector administrator

The next slide(s) show how the trust relationship is created.

Creating the Cloud-to-OnPremise trust in the SAP Cloud Connector

To add the new system map


provide the following information
for each screen :-
 Backend Type : ABAP System
 Protocol : HTTPS
 Internal Host : <actual hostname>
 Internal Port : <actual HTTPS port>
 Principal Type : None
 Host in req Header : Internal Host
 Description : <describe the mapped
system>

INTERNAL – SAP and Customers Only 24


Creating the Cloud-to-OnPremise trust in the SAP Cloud Connector

Then add 2 URL resources


 Click the ‘+ ‘ sign to add a URL resource
 URL resources are:-
– /sap/opu/odata/sap/ProcessManagement
Description : SolMan ProcMgmt API
– /sap/bc/icf/info
Description : System Info API

Synchronisation Project: map dictionary
Mapping of Dictionary is used to select or create a dictionary category in SAP Signavio that will be linked to SAP Solution Manager Process library and used by
the connector for synchronisation of process activities (Activity object type in SAP Signavio and Process Step <Orig.> in SAP Solution manager).

Please note, only one Dictionary category can be mapped. It is not possible to map Dictionary sub-category. All Activity object types used in synchronisation
must be stored in the mapped Dictionary Category, if synchronisation direction is SAP Signavio to SAP Solution Manager. All Process Steps from the Process
Step Library and it’s lower level folders and sub-folders will be imported into the mapped category, if synchronisation direction is SAP Solution Manager to SAP
Signavio.

If the initial synchronisation is SAP Solution


Manager to SAP Signavio, then the
connector default Dictionary category is
‘SAP Process Steps’ can be used and it
will be created in SAP Signavio when the
project is activated.
If you would like to create a dedicate
Dictionary category automatically via the
connector, type here the name of the
Category and press ‘enter’.
If the initial synchronisation is SAP
Signavio to SAP Solution Manager, then
you will need to chose the dictionary from
SAP Signavio. Start typing the name of the
required Dictionary and it will pop up in the
drop down list.

Synchronisation Project: map Customized attributes
Customized attributes are optional. For object types that are in scope of synchronisation (BPMN Process Models, Tasks,
Process Steps, etc.), existing standard and customer attributes from SAP Signavio and SAP Solution Manager systems
can be mapped here. Please note that data element types and length is not controlled automatically and would require the
end use to select attributes of matching data types

Supported attribute types:

SAP Signavio to SAP Solution Manager:


 Boolean -> Boolean
 Single-line text -> Single-line text
 Multi-line text -> Multi-line text
 Dictionary link -> Single-line Text
 Dictionary link (list) -> Multi-line text

Please note, if attribute types that are not supported mapped in the SAP Solution Manager to SAP Signavio:
synchronisation project in error, the project activation may fail.  Boolean -> Boolean
 Single-line text -> Single-line text
 Multi-line text -> Multi-line text

Run Synchronisation: monitor synchronisation in Phase 5
Phase 5 is only used in synchronisation to SAP Signavio to show progress of imported BPMN Diagrams of SAP Solution Manger. The import covers both types of the
diagrams: Collaboration and Process Diagram.

You might be able to see some errors in processing of the Diagrams, however the whole status of synchronisation will be set to Complete. Diagram often have missing
Process Steps (e.g. it’s blank), missing XML that wasn’t generated in SAP Solution Manager when the diagram was imported/created or deleted Process Steps (e.g.
deleted from the structure, but not the diagram. Due to a low impact impact on consistency of the synchronisation, the synchronisation is considered as ‘Complete’.

Error Message DIAGRAM object type Reason


SOL-SIG Sync errored for ObjectType: The Diagram is empty and does not
DIAGRAM with error: Map internal to external contain any object inside the diagram,
failed for direction: SOLMAN2SPM with error : e.g. empty diagram.
TypeError: Cannot read properties of
undefined (reading 'ATTRIBUTES') with name
and ID.

SOL-SIG Sync errored for ObjectType: The Diagram is missing


DIAGRAM with error: Map internal to external BPMNInterchangeXML for the
failed for direction: SOLMAN2SPM with error : connector to export the diagram to
TypeError: Cannot read properties of Signavio. Seems like diagram was
undefined (reading 'DATA') with name and ID. imported to SolMan from an external
source and the xml wasn't generated by
SolMan, therefore it's not available in
the API to pass to the connector.

SOL-SIG Sync errored for ObjectType: The Diagram contains object


DIAGRAM with error: Map internal to external (tasks/process steps) that have been
Example of ERROR failed for direction: SOLMAN2SPM with error : deleted or not inside the current
message when Diagram is TypeError: Cannot read properties of process structure. So connector can
blank undefined (reading 'systemAObjectID') with not find the reference objects.
name and ID.
